The Ukrainian Zelenskyy arrives at the summit of the European Political Community in Moldova
President Volodymyr Zelenskyy said on Thursday during a trip to Moldova that Ukraine was ready to join the NATO military alliance and that Kiev hoped the bloc would be ready to admit his country. He also reiterated Ukraine’s desire to join the European Union after arriving in Moldova, which borders Ukraine, for a summit that will bring together more than 40 European leaders. The summit is intended to show support for the two countries as Kiev prepares to launch a counter-offensive against Russia’s invasion. Trump Was Caught On Tape Admitting To Keeping Classified Documents: Report – Rolling Stone
The DOJ apparently has a recording of the former president saying he knew he couldn’t simply declassify documents after he left the White House. Donald Trump’s statement that he had declassified the large amount of government documents he brought to Mar-a-Lago was questionable from the start. Well, CNN reported on Wednesday that federal prosecutors overseeing the documents probe have obtained a recording of the former president admitting he kept a classified document containing information about a proposed attack plan against Iran. WASHINGTON (AP) – Shunning a default crisis, the House overwhelmingly approved a package of debt ceiling and budget cuts, sending the deal that President Joe Biden and Speaker Kevin McCarthy brokered to the Senate for quick approval in a matter of days, ahead of a fast-approaching deadline. The hard-fought compromise pleased few, but lawmakers said it was better than the alternative: devastating economic upheaval if Congress failed to act.
